The Imperative of Environmentally Sustainable Production

The global shift towards environmental consciousness has had a profound impact on chemical manufacturing. Regulatory pressures, consumer preferences, and ethical considerations have converged to make sustainable practices not just an option but a necessity. Among the various strategies that chemical manufacturers can adopt to reduce their ecological footprint, optimizing production scheduling stands out as a potent tool. By streamlining production processes, minimizing waste, and optimizing resource utilization, scheduling becomes an instrument for achieving higher operational efficiency and reduced environmental impact.

The Integration Advantage: Scheduling and ERP, SCM, MES Systems

Integrating scheduling solutions with ERP, SCM, and MES systems opens up a realm of possibilities for enhancing sustainability in chemical manufacturing. Let's explore how this integration can be achieved using leading platforms:

Integration with SAP: By marrying PlanetTogether's advanced scheduling capabilities with SAP's robust ERP system, Manufacturing IT Managers can gain real-time insights into production schedules, resource allocation, and material availability. This integration allows for seamless coordination between production plans and business processes, resulting in reduced energy consumption, minimized waste, and optimal utilization of assets.

Leveraging Oracle: The synergy between PlanetTogether and Oracle enables Manufacturing IT Managers to create agile production schedules that align with demand forecasts and inventory levels. This integration paves the way for just-in-time production, thereby reducing excess inventory and the associated environmental impact. Moreover, real-time data synchronization empowers decision-makers to adapt quickly to changing market conditions while minimizing disruptions to the production ecosystem.

Microsoft Dynamics for Sustainable Manufacturing: Integrating PlanetTogether with Microsoft Dynamics opens avenues for predictive scheduling and resource optimization. With data-driven insights, Manufacturing IT Managers can strategize production in a way that reduces energy-intensive operations during peak utility hours. Additionally, the integration allows for a holistic view of the supply chain, enabling efficient transportation planning and emissions reduction.

Kinaxis and Agile Scheduling: Chemical manufacturing is notorious for its complexity, which makes dynamic scheduling critical. Integrating PlanetTogether with Kinaxis empowers manufacturers to respond swiftly to unforeseen disruptions, minimizing downtimes and resource wastage. This integration is pivotal in achieving lean manufacturing practices that inherently lead to reduced environmental impact.

Aveva's Contribution: Combining PlanetTogether's scheduling prowess with Aveva's MES solution leads to synchronized shop floor operations. This integration enhances visibility into production processes, enabling proactive maintenance that prolongs the lifespan of equipment. The resultant reduction in machinery replacement not only conserves resources but also minimizes the environmental toll of manufacturing.
